- I did briefly look into how much the estimated $7B was as a proportion of GDP: 7B/2T = 0.35% of GDP, which feels like a lot. For 41 planes it'd be $170M per plane, which seems reasonable when compared to US bombers, but unclear for Russian ones, but my guess is it's not too far off. This source (https://www.france24.com/en/europe/20250601-ukraine-says-it-...) says $2B for the planes alone, but then you also had the airbases &c, and maybe a submarine base <https://newsukraine.rbc.ua/news/major-explosion-hits-russian...>. I'd still expect it to be a bit exaggerated for propaganda effects, but it does seem reasonable all in all.

- > Can a board member be reasonably responsible for the actions of tens of thousands of employees if they have not explicitly enabled or condoned criminal behaviour?
Not sure what the answer is, but if the answer is yes, then that incentivizes them to build the oversight and reporting capabilities to be able to steer away from crime, and to hire noncriminal subordinates &c.
One way this could look in practice is board members having to post a large bond that gets taken away if the commpany is found to commit crimes during their tenure.
Anecdotically, the Real Madrid requires a large bond (57M) posted by the president. http://news.bbc.co.uk/sport1/hi/football/europe/8076515.stm

Because imports are slowing, especially from China, shortages of some imported goods are expected to become noticeable in the coming weeks and to become substantial around August. If tariffs continue, some of these shortages may become pronounced; prices will increase dramatically for other goods. We recommend that those in the US consider buying imported goods before shortages and large price increases arrive.
Forecasters also discussed the possibility of shortages caused merely by self-fulfilling prophecy. For instance, the majority of toilet paper for US consumption is produced domestically, and so, one might naïvely think that as shelves start to empty of other products, toilet paper inventories will not be affected. However, shelves might empty of some products simply because people expect them to, even of products that are not substantially affected by tariffs.

- The android app fits lognormals, and 90% rather than 95% confidence intervals. I think they are a more parsimonious distribution for doing these kinds of estimates. One hint might be that, per the central limit theorem, sums of independent variables will tend to normals, which means that products will tend to be lognormals, and for the decompositions quick estimates are most useful, multiplications are more common

- Fermi in particular has the following syntax
```
5M 12M # number of people living in Chicago
beta 1 200 # fraction of people that have a piano
30 180 # minutes it takes to tune a piano, including travel time
/ 48 52 # weeks a year that piano tuners work for
/ 5 6 # days a week in which piano tuners work
/ 6 8 # hours a day in which piano tuners work
/ 60 # minutes to an hour
```
multiplication is implied as the default operation, fits are lognormal.
